Amazon MGM Studios has officially begun the search for
the next actor to take on the role of James Bond.
The studio confirmed that the casting process for the
iconic British spy is now underway, marking a major step forward for the future
of the long-running 007 franchise.
A spokesperson for Amazon MGM Studios said the company
would not disclose specific details while casting is ongoing but promised that
updates would be shared with fans when appropriate.
“While we don't plan to comment on specific details
during the casting process, we're excited to share more news with 007 fans as
soon as the time is right,” the spokesperson said.
According to industry sources, respected casting
director Nina Gold has been hired to assist in finding the next 007.
Gold is best known for her work on the hit series
*Game of Thrones* and has also been involved in several major Hollywood
productions.
Details of the casting process remain confidential,
and there is currently no official information on which actors may be
auditioning or being considered for the role.
The development is one of the most significant updates
for Bond fans since Daniel Craig left the franchise after *No Time to Die* was
released in 2021.
Speculation about the future of James Bond has
continued since Amazon acquired MGM, giving the company control of the Bond
intellectual property.
Before the casting update, the biggest confirmed news
about the next Bond film was that Dune director Denis Villeneuve had been
chosen to direct the upcoming instalment.
The search for the next James Bond is expected to
attract major attention across the film industry, as fans eagerly wait to see
who will inherit one of cinema’s most famous roles.
